L&M-985 var.; K-Mule Obv. plate 194 #2, Rev. plate 194 #1. VERY RARE. Struck in bronze. Appears to be a Mule of the Second Class obverse with the reverse for the First Class. In November of 1906, the Qing government reorganized and created a new combined department of Agriculture, Industry, and Commercial affairs. Thus, these medals were most likely issued starting in 1907. Two side view dragons with flaming pearl between surrounded by clouds, waves below. Class designation below pearl. Reverse shows Manchu script in legend to left, Chinese to right. Two Chinese characters in center at top and bottom. Two Manchu characters at left and right in center.
